<br />MINUTES OF THE MEETING OF THE COUNCIL <br />OF THE CITY OF NORTH OLMSTED <br />JULY 3, 1984 <br />Present: President James Boehmer, Councilmen Bierman, O'Grady, Petrigac, <br />Rademaker, Saringer, Tallon, Wilamosky. <br />Also present: Mayor Robert Swietyniowski, Law Director Michael Gareau, Finance <br />Director Edward Boyle, Acting Clerk of Council Linda Spencer. <br />Meeting was called to order by President Boehmer at 8:00 P.M. <br />Members of the audience were invited to join Members of Council in reciting the <br />Pledge of Allegiance. <br />Minutes of the Council Meeting of June 19, 19$4 were approved. <br />President Boehmer announced that in-the absence of Florence Campbell, Linda Spencer <br />would be Acting Clerk of Council. Also, Ordinance Nos. 84-63, 84-64 and 84-65 'sre <br />being added to tonight's agenda. <br />Mayor Swietyniowski reported: 1) Welcomed everyone to the first Council Meeting in <br />the new chambers; has been unable to get the sound system completely adjusted. <br />Thanked Bob Prickett and John Yasher for the excellent job they did in building the <br />desks, podiums and table and preparing the chambers, conference and caucus rooms. <br />2) Thanked NOSO President, Doctor Dick Bokany, board members and parents who made <br />NOSO Cup 1984 a big success. <br />3) Fourth of July fireworks display will start at approximately 9:45 P.M. with a <br />rain date scheduled for Saturday. Thanked Great Northern Mall and Plaza merchants <br />as well as the Parks and Recreation Department for sponsoring this event. <br />Finance Director Boyle reported: 1) Lorain Avenue note sale of $205,000 will be <br />closed on July 17th at a rate of 8.05% negotiated through McDonald and Company. <br />2) Talked to Mr. Ken Cox, Director of the Ohio Department of Highway Safety with <br />respect to a problem with motor vehicle registration revenues. City has not received <br />its total distribution. Solution of the problem will require legislative action by <br />the Ohio Legislation and City should receive the major portion of this money during <br />this calendar year. A few years ago, when these accounts became delinquent, a fund <br />was set up and the interest earned on this fund will also be distributed to the City. <br />3) Also spoke with members of the Federal Department of Natural Resources about <br />possible funding for the Recreation Complex. This is still being investigated as <br />well as funding for North Olmsted Park for next year. <br />4) Had previously reported to Council about a bond sale for this year; City will not <br />be doing the bond sale; are going to stay with notes since the bond market is too <br />volati]e right now. Will be introducing legislation for the notes to be dated for a <br />period in September, to go for one year, to hopefully capture a lower interest rate. <br />5) PERS Annual Reports are now available in Finance Department. <br />6) Mr. Boyle was elected to the Regional Income Tax Board of Trustees to fill the un- <br />expired term of Allen Mills. <br />
